A supervisory enrichment program based on flipped learning for a sample of school counseling students at the university
Flipped learning represents an unconventional approach aimed at empowering students. This study sought to assess the impact of an enrichment supervisory program utilizing flipped learning on enhancing motivation for learning and academic achievement.
